Thomas Edison & Henry Ford Winter

Thomas Edison & Henry Ford Winter reported paying Michael A Flanders, President/ce, $171,700 in total compensation (FY 2023).

That places Michael A Flanders at approximately the 44th percentile among 32 similarly sized arts, culture & humanities nonprofits (median $181,381).
